1757 Virginia

1757- Samuel Potts, the eldest son of David Potts and Ann Roberts, marries out of meeting. Because he refuses to confess the error of outgoing, he is disowned by Friends.

(Samuel Potts is my 5th great grand uncle. Our common ancestors are David Potts and Ann Roberts.)
